Hi, my DD is 12 and has been wearing glasses for short sightedness for a few years now. She also has always had a bit of an astigmatism. Her prescription for the myopia went from -0.5 to -1.5 and -0.5 to -1.75 in a year so they recommended myopic management glasses, which she's been wearing for a year.

Hey big brother is also using myopic management glasses and it seems to have slowed down his prescription changes. Their dad and I both have strong prescriptions (-5.5 ish).

However, when I took DD to the opticians this week, they said she's not short sighted at all, just really astigmatic. Her new prescription is SPH 0.0/0.0 CYL -1.5/-2.5 AXIS 5.0/175

I'm confused! How can she not be short sighted any more? Or was her prescription wrong before? Or could it be wrong now?
